In a season where the Seahawks exceeded most every expectation by winning their last five regular season games in a row, going 11-5 and winning a first round playoff game on the road, you might think there aren’t many items on the Seahawks’ “to-do” list before the 2013 season starts. After all, the Seahawks had the top scoring defense in 2012, one of the league’s best rushing attacks, and arguably the league’s top rookie signal caller in Russell Wilson, so the cupboards aren’t bare by any stretch of the imagination. However, as with any up-and-coming team that experiences a breakthrough season the way Seahawks did, there’s a lot of work to be done in order to build on the success and equip the team to handle the inevitable increase in expectations next season.So what are the goals that are bound to be on the New Year resolution list for John Schneider and Pete Carroll for 2013? Seahawks QB Russell Wilson Never Asked For New Contract
On Sunday Chris Mortensen of ESPN reported that Russell Wilson's agent contacted the Seahawks and asked for his rookie contract to be redone in light of his play this year. The CBA prohibits restructuring a rookie deal until the third year of the contract.
Buss Cook, the agent for Wilson, denied Mortensen's report by saying "I know you cant do that yet."
